Transaction f0763cef928156d7e8f4c93e18c3b3fd4fc33e2877e0d07f94a719aed297e185
1 Input
2 Outputs
- f0763cef928156d7e8f4c93e18c3b3fd4fc33e2877e0d07f94a719aed297e185:0
- f0763cef928156d7e8f4c93e18c3b3fd4fc33e2877e0d07f94a719aed297e185:1
value 3423954
address 3MxSsKUvwMrHfMfjizRzDybFcShR4Knf6D
value 15571506
address 1Dmk2HSkpbUXZjYK6tS2YQruaPPdbfnFD5